Backflow service involves inspecting, testing, and repairing backflow prevention devices to ensure that drinking water remains safe and free from contamination. These devices are installed within a property's plumbing system to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the public water supply. Regular testing and maintenance of backflow preventers are essential to confirm they are functioning properly and to address any issues that could compromise water quality. Professionals specializing in backflow services can help property owners maintain compliance with local regulations and ensure their plumbing systems operate safely.

This service is particularly valuable in addressing problems related to backflow incidents, such as water contamination caused by cross-connections between potable and non-potable water sources. Common signs of potential backflow issues include foul odors, discolored water, or irregular water pressure. By having backflow preventers tested and serviced regularly, property owners can prevent costly repairs, health hazards, and regulatory violations. Proper backflow prevention is crucial in maintaining a safe water supply, especially in properties where water systems are complex or exposed to potential cross-connections.

Commercial properties, such as restaurants, factories, and office buildings, frequently utilize backflow prevention services due to their complex plumbing systems and higher risk factors. Additionally, residential properties with irrigation systems, well water connections, or fire suppression systems may also require regular backflow testing and maintenance. Properties located in areas with strict water safety regulations often mandate routine backflow device inspections to ensure ongoing compliance. These services help property owners avoid penalties and maintain the safety of their water systems.

The overview below groups typical Backflow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in London,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Service Call Fees - Typical costs for a backflow service call range from $150 to $350, depending on the complexity of the inspection or repair needed. These fees usually cover the technician’s visit and initial assessment.

Backflow Device Testing - Testing services generally cost between $75 and $200 per device. Prices vary based on the number of devices and the accessibility of the installation site.

Repair and Replacement - Repair costs can range from $200 to $1,000 or more, depending on the extent of the issue. Replacement of a backflow preventer may cost between $500 and $2,000, including parts and labor.

Preventive Maintenance - Routine maintenance services typically fall within the $100 to $300 range. Regular inspections help ensure proper functioning and may prevent costly repairs later.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is backflow prevention? Backflow prevention involves installing devices to stop cont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ply.

Why is backflow testing important? Regular testing ensures that backflow prevention devices are functioning properly to protect water quality.

How often should backflow devices be serviced? It is typically recommended to have backflow devices inspected and serviced annually by a professional.

What signs indicate a backflow issue? Unusual water pressure, foul odors, or discolored water may suggest a backflow problem requiring inspection.
